My class is reading Barry Lyga’s fascinating and tense I Hunt Killers, which starts with this premise: “What if the world’s worst serial killer… was your dad?” The novel is about teenager Jasper (Jazz) Dent, whose father is responsible for atrocious deaths in the triple digits. Although Billy Dent has been put behind bars, Jasper still has to deal with his legacy—and soon, with a lot more, since it seems that a copycat serial killer has begun leaving bodies in Jazz’s home town. Jazz has an all-too intimate knowledge of how serial killers work, and he feels that it’s up to him to solve the mystery of who is responsible for the murders.
